About Blalack Middle

Blalack Middle is a public middle school in Carrollton, TX, part of Carrollton-farmers Branch ISD, serving approximately 889 students in grades 6th-8th with a 13.7: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 7.7 out of 10 and ranks #1,984 of 8,552 schools in TX. State assessment records show 71%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 72%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).

Frequently asked questions

Common questions about Blalack Middle

What grades does Blalack Middle serve?

Blalack Middle serves students in grades 6th through 8th.

How many students attend Blalack Middle?

Blalack Middle has an enrollment of approximately 889 students.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Blalack Middle?

The student-teacher ratio at Blalack Middle is 13.7:1. A lower ratio generally means more individual attention per student. The national average is approximately 16:1 for public schools.

How does Blalack Middle rank in TX?

Blalack Middle ranks #1,984 of 8,552 schools in TX.

What is Blalack Middle's MySchoolScout rating?

Blalack Middle has a current MySchoolScout rating of 7.7 out of 10. This score combines the level-appropriate components shown in the rating breakdown; equity data is shown separately for context.

What are the test scores at Blalack Middle?

Based on loaded state assessment records, Blalack Middle has 71%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 72%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).

Is Blalack Middle a charter school?

No, Blalack Middle is not a charter school. It is a traditional public school operated by the local school district.

Is Blalack Middle a Title I school?

No, Blalack Middle is not currently a Title I school.

What does the Free & Reduced Lunch percentage mean for Blalack Middle?

54.1% of students at Blalack Middle q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. This is a commonly used indicator of economic need and provides important context when interpreting test scores.
